Jennifer Trask Intrinsecus

The Museum of Art and Design (MAD) in NYC might not be your first stop. In a city so full of art and culture, museums and galleries galore, it might not even be your second stop. But I can honestly say, it should at least make the list. The current exhibit, Dead of Alive: Nature Becomes Art is captivating.  It’s a collection of work “from 30 international artists  who transform organic materials and objects that were once produced by or part of living organisms-insects, feathers, bones, silkworm cocoons, plant materials, and hair-to create intricately crafted and designed installations and sculptures”.  Whether you are a fan of organic materials or not it will win you over.

Art/Design Featured Gallery Take a Trip to the Dirtyland With Brian Viveros

October 7, 2010 - 11:54 am

Brian Viveros is a celebrated fetish artist, known mainly for his erotic paintings of smokey eyed pin-up girls with cigarettes dangling from their overly red lips. His recent show, The Dirtyland just opened this past weekend at Thinkspace Gallery . With images of strong women in situations of war and struggle, one would think the show might come off dark. On the contrary, it doesn’t position woman as victim, but fearless, seductive and entirely bad ass.

Music INNERPARTYSYSTEM Signs to Red Bull Records

August 23, 2010 - 6:12 pm

Innerpartysystem_-_Apple_Store

American dance group, INNERPARTYSYSTEM just signed to Red Bull Records. The creative  trio consists of Patrick Nissley, Jared Piccone and Kris Barman and has been making music you have probably heard and loved since 2007. Known mostly for their endearing and energetic remixes of such songs as ‘Hot N Cold’ by Katy Perry, ‘Don’t Trust M’ by 3OH!3 and ‘Human’ by The Killers, they have the ability to get your body moving on the dance floor.

In the Summer of 2009, the band announced on their official MySpace and Facebook pages that they had parted ways with their label, Island Records. They wrote, “There are some really amazing, overworked, underpaid, stressed out people who love music, working very hard there… and there are a handful of people who just didn’t really understand this band, and didn’t know how to react when ‘Don’t Stop’ wasn’t ‘Just Dance.’ Our bad there.”

In May of 2010 they self-released the EP American Trash, which exhibited a fresh and polished sound that made the industry perk up their ears. Their music is like a well blended cocktail of straight razors, motor oil, premium vodka and chewing gum. Its accessible, eclectic,  thumping, melodic masterpieces. Just last week they announced they signed to the ever growing roster on Red Bull Records out of Santa Monica, CA.
